Installing FX2V in The Red Jacket pump <br /> DO NOT overtighten. <br /> iff See technical bulletin#042-111-1 for use of Snap Tap Connector assembly. <br /> 7. Connect power to pump at the load center. <br /> 8. Clear remaining air from system as follows: <br /> a. Turn on dispenser that is farthest from the leak detector but do not open nozzle.Wait 4 or 5 minutes <br /> or more. Look for leaks on parts worked on. <br /> b. Shut off the pump and allow it to stand four or five minutes.Then start the pump again and open the <br /> nozzle farthest from the leak detector. <br /> c. Continue to dispense enough gasoline, about 20 to 30 gallons (76 to 114 liters),to pump ALL air <br /> from the system. <br /> 5 <br />
